Transform Your Financial Wellness with Weekly Money Dates 👩❤️💋👩💰
One of my favorite money self-care practices that I started the past year is weekly money dates. A money date is simply a set time in your schedule to take a look at your money. It can be a solo event, or done with a partner or anyone else you share expenses with.
